Jeremy Majewski is a software engineer with 15 years of experience building reliable web applications and backend systems, currently at Google in the Wroclaw area. He is proficient in Linux, Python and Django, and has a strong self-taught background in algorithms and system design. Jeremy contributes to notable open-source projects—improving search architecture in the Zeal offline documentation browser and hardening Yelp’s detect-secrets tool by fixing edge cases and strengthening keyword detection. He blends practical engineering with a security-minded attention to detail, often improving robustness and test coverage in existing codebases. Jeremy’s trajectory shows a pattern of tackling tricky backend problems and integrating cleaner architectures into production tooling.

zealdocs/zeal

Jan 2013 - Nov 2017

Offline documentation browser inspired by Dash
Role in this project:
userBack-end Developer
Contributions:239 commits, 10 PRs, 12 pushes in 4 years 10 months
Contributions summary:Jeremy primarily focused on improving the offline documentation browser's search functionality. This involved implementing a separate thread for handling queries, enhancing the search model, and integrating it with the UI elements. The commits show modifications to database interactions, and API. The user also introduced a class for search result storage and improved the general architecture of the search system.

Yelp/detect-secrets

Oct 2018 - Oct 2018

An enterprise friendly way of detecting and preventing secrets in code.
Role in this project:
userSecurity Engineer
Contributions:5 commits, 1 PR, 1 comment in 1 day
Contributions summary:Jeremy focused on improving the `detect-secrets` tool, specifically its ability to identify secrets within code. Their contributions include fixing bugs in the keyword plugin related to secret detection, handling edge cases like files lacking newline characters, and simplifying the plugin's internal logic. They also added a test case to ensure the tool correctly identifies uppercase keywords, enhancing the tool's robustness.
